TM's WiiKey Review

So TM has got hold of a Wiikey and as all ways have taken the time to do a full on review, As I have not got hold of TM to ask if its ok to post all the hard work here you can read the full thing HERE

Quote:
WiiKey Postives

- Easy to install, do it via the quicksolder way or with wires.
- No need to flash the chip.
- Chip is well made, very durable.
- Boots Wii & GC backups flawlessly
- Region free (boots imports)
- Compatible with all Wii models.

WiiKey Negatives

- Upgradability for the chip seems a bit limited for the time being.
- Somewhat expensive.

Final Thoughts...

I am going to rate this product using a basic A-F grading system, A being the best and F being the worst.

Ease of install.................A
Quality of chip................A
Booting Backups..............A
Durability........................A
Chip options....................B
Upgradability..................A
Price................................C+

Overall Grade..................A-

To everybody who is thinking about buying this chip, I highly recommend that you do. The Wiikey had me sold from the moment I saw that backup game boot. I highly recommend this chip to everybody who would like to mod out their Wii! Fork over the cash, you wont regret it!
